SALT LAKE CITY – Justin Gaethje doesn’t hold the lightweight title, but he’s in an unusual position where he may hold a lot more cards than most top contenders. In the UFC 291 main event Saturday at Delta Center in Salt Lake City, Gaethje (25-4 MMA, 8-4 UFC) once again lived through frames of his life that would’ve been unconceivable decades ago. “This is such a cool life,” Gaethje told MMA Junkie and other reporters at a post-fight news conference. “I couldn’t imagine I’d be here as a child
